1. Orlando Fringe

When most people hear the words “Orlando culture,” their minds immediately conjure corny images of anthropomorphic animals and faux castles. re-evaluate for 2 weeks every May, one among the world’s best performance festivals takes place in Orlando. From quirky cabarets to thought-provoking one-act plays, Orlando Fringe features dozens of unique music, comedy, and theatrical acts starring both local and visiting artists. There are over 100 shows, so make certain to review the program and buy tickets beforehand.

2. Halloween Horror Nights

For nearly 30 years, Universal Studios has been home to Orlando’s freakiest Halloween celebration. Beginning in September, the amusement park morphs on select nights into a knuckle-bitingly spooky hellscape with mazes and “scare zones” supported both original creepy concepts and people inspired by popular horror franchises, like The Purge, Halloween, and Friday the 13th. With top-notch production values, the event has become immensely popular. It’s worth considering upgrading a typical ticket with a pass that permits you to skip ahead and not worry about the long lines.

3. Florida Strawberry Festival

Where else are you able to say you’ve tried a strawberry burger? For an annual homage to all or any things strawberry, head about an hour outside Orlando to Plant City, an agriculturally vital area that boasts about 10,000 acres of strawberries. The 11-day extravaganza draws over 500,000 attendees for a delicious mixture of attractions, eating contests, and concerts. it is a berry blast for all ages. (Sorry, we couldn’t resist.)

4. Florida festival

The Enzian, the city’s beloved independent cinema, helps organize this annual movie festival where the work of filmmakers from around the globe is showcased at venues across Central Florida. The festival screens over 180 films in genres starting from cerebral to comical. Who knows? you only might see an Oscar contender waaaay before all of your friends.

5. Winter Park Sidewalk Art Festival

One of the nation’s oldest and most prestigious juried outdoor art festivals, this sprawling event is held each March along Park Avenue within the trendy neighborhood of Winter Park. Each year, the happening draws quite 350,000 visitors to ascertain the works of over 200 artists whose mediums include watercolors, sculpture, glass, and almost anything you’ll imagine. Whether you’re an art collector or gawker, it’s worth a visit.

6. MegaCon

You don’t get to attend San Diego to totally geek out. Central Florida’s largest comic and media convention draws big names from the realms of TV, film, comics, and more for a mammoth pop-culture fest held per annum at the Orange County Convention Center. additionally, to celebrities, MegaCon is heavily populated by fun-loving cosplayers, those costumed folks who bring fictional characters to life outside of a topic park.
